Job Description

As Integration Senior Manager, you will define how systems, data, and digital capabilities come together across Marshall Group. You will own the integration strategy and platform, while building and scaling a dedicated integration function that supports our ERP, eCommerce, PIM, and wider application landscape. This role sits at the centre of our digital ecosystem and plays a key part in enabling stable operations, efficient end-to-end processes, and future growth.

Job Responsibility

  • Define and drive the Group-wide integration strategy and roadmap
  • Own and evolve the Azure integration platform with a focus on scalability, stability, and security
  • Build, lead, and develop a high-performing integration team, including nearshore capabilities
  • Ensure reliable data flows and strong ownership across key business systems
  • Establish best practices for integration architecture, monitoring, governance, and compliance

Requirements

  • At least 5 years of experience leading integration platforms or integration-focused teams
  • Hands-on expertise with Azure Integration Services such as Logic Apps, Service Bus, Event Grid, and API Management
  • Experience building and managing teams, including distributed or nearshore setups
  • Strong understanding of integration patterns, APIs, and data flows across enterprise systems
  • Experience with data platforms, BI, or AI initiatives is a strong advantage
